The process of ageing is a complex one. It occurs at different levels. Changes include thinning of the skeletal structure of our face, loss of muscle and fatty tissues as well as pigmentation, thinning and reduction of elasticity of our skin.

Cosmetic injections can cause a range of side effects, most of which are mild and temporary. Common effects include redness, swelling, bruising, tenderness, or small lumps at the injection site, usually resolving within a few days. Some people may experience headaches, mild flu-like symptoms, or temporary muscle weakness. Some procedures may occasionally lead to asymmetry, firmness under the skin, or delayed swelling. Rare but serious complication such as infection, allergic reactions, or accidental injection into a blood vessel can occur and may require medical attention

SAFETY FIRST

An ethical approach to this aspect of medicine is essential for both the physical and emotional safety of our patients and clients. Each new patient is given a brief series of questions to exclude Body Dysmorphic Disorder and is offered a cooling off period to allow them time to consider their options.

Please remember, these are elective and non-essential procedures. Safety is our first consideration and every step along your journey is entirely focused on this.
